#062059 Hex Color Code

#062059

The Hexadecimal Color #062059 is a contrast shade of Midnight Blue. #062059 RGB value is rgb(6, 32, 89). RGB Color Model of #062059 consists of 2% red, 12% green and 34% blue. HSL color Mode of #062059 has 221°(degrees) Hue, 87% Saturation and 19% Lightness. #062059 color has an wavelength of 480.85185n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#062059 is #333366.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#062059 is #025. The Closest Color to #062059 is #191970. Official Name of #062059 Hex Code is Downriver.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#062059 is 93 Cyan 64 Magenta 0 Yellow 65 Black and #062059 CMY is 93, 64,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#062059 is hsl(221,87,19,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(221, 93, 35).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#062059 is 2.39, 1.79, 9.67.
Hex8 Value of #062059 is #062059FF. Decimal Value of #062059 is 401497 and Octal Value of #062059 is 1420131. Binary Value of #062059 is 110, 100000, 1011001 and Android of #062059 is 4278591577 / 0xff062059.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#062059 is 0.173, 0.129, 0.129 and YIQ Color Space of #062059 is 30.724, -33.8075, 12.2394.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#062059 is 0.95, 1.42, 9.54.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#062059 is 14.34, 15.69, -36.91.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#062059 is 14.34, -6.29, -35.76.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#062059 is 14.34, 40.11, 293.03. Hunter Lab variable of #062059 is 13.38, 8.47, -33.49.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#062059

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
